Twitter suspended Kangana Ranaut's account permanently for violating its rules around hate speech. However, app Koo welcomed the Queen actor and said, “Kangana Jee, this is your home, you can voice your opinions to everyone here with pride. Twitter removed Kangana permanently after her controversial tweets on post-poll violence in West Bengal, which were seen as a call to violence. The company said in a statement, “We’ve been clear that we will take strong enforcement action on behaviour that has the potential to lead to offline harm. 

The referenced account has been permanently suspended for repeated violations of Twitter Rules. specifically our Hateful Conduct policy and Abusive Behaviour policy. We enforce the Twitter Rules judiciously and impartially for everyone on our service. ”Responding to Twitter suspending her account, Kangana said in an official statement, “Twitter has only proved my point they are Americans and by birth a white person feels entitled to enslave a brown person, they want to tell you what to think, speak or do, fortunately I have many platforms I can use to raise my voice including my own art in the form of cinema but my heart goes out to the people of this nation who have been tortured, enslaved and censored for thousands of years and still their is no end to the suffering.” On the work front, she will be seen in Thalaivi next. She also has films like, Dhaakad and Tejas in her kitty.
